About Claudia Fabiani
Claudia Fabiani is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Rheumatology, Hematology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Hepatology, having authored 95 papers that have together received 2.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Ocular Diseases and Behçet’s Syndrome (68 papers), Retinal and Optic Conditions (37 papers), Systemic Lupus Erythematosus Research (37 papers), Vasculitis and related conditions (20 papers), Otitis Media and Relapsing Polychondritis (12 papers), Autoimmune and Inflammatory Disorders Research (10 papers), Inflammasome and immune disorders (10 papers) and Retinal Diseases and Treatments (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ophthalmology (1.2k citations), Rheumatology (759 citations), Hematology (189 cit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(366 citations) and Immunology (180 citations). Claudia Fabiani has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, Spain and United States. Frequent co-authors include Luca Cantarini, Bruno Frediani, Giuseppe Lopalco, Jurgen Sota, Antonio Vitale, Donato Rigante, Gian Marco Tosi, Florenzo Iannone, Giacomo Emmi and Mauro Galeazzi. Their work appears in journals such as Clinical Rheumatology, Ocular Immunology and Inflammation, Internal and Emergency Medicine, Frontiers in Immunology and European Journal of Ophthalmology.
